## Account Recovery — Trailnote Offline Mode

When a surveyor's Trailnote app has been offline for 30+ days, their local credentials expire and sync refuses to resume. Don't make them wipe the device — all their unsynced field data lives there! Instead, open the support console, pick "Offline Reinstate," and enter their handle. The console will ask for the support team's shared recovery passphrase before issuing a reinstatement token. Use the one below.

unlock words, bagaf-fajeg: zorael-kelax-fraath-quenix-eliok-sileth-aldmir-wenir-druiel

Quick orientation for reviewers: Verdanta runs the greenhouse climate loops in dev (bench rig), staging (the test tunnel), and prod (the actual greenhouses). The fun wrinkle is sensor drift — the humidity probes wander a few percent per month, so each environment applies its own calibration offsets and a drift-correction window. Staging deliberately uses looser thresholds to catch regressions early. Nothing here touches external networks. The prod environment currently runs with the following configuration values.

deployment values, yafop-tahof:
HOLIX_HOST=holix.zemvarsys.internal
HOLIX_PORT=3306

## Changelog — Ticktrace 1.9

### Renamed: DRIFT_API_TOKEN
During the cron drift investigation we found plugins confusing this variable with the metrics token, so it has been renamed to indicate it authorizes drift-report uploads specifically. Plugin authors must read the new name from 1.9 onward; the old name is ignored without warning. Sample env files in the SDK are updated. In your deployment env file, the drift-report upload secret is set on the next line.

env line for fawef-taguf: VAULT_KEY13=a9695905a9a90

## ProfileVault Sharding — Environments

ProfileVault shards the user-profile store by account hash across 16 partitions in prod, 4 in staging. Support: shard lookups go through the router, never query partitions directly. Rebalances run Sundays; expect brief read-only windows. If a customer reports stale profile data, check the shard router health page first. The staging router runs with the following configuration values.

service settings:
[casax]
port = 6379
team = rusir
host = casax.zemvarhq.corp
region = outer-4
access_code = ac_9808ce
timeout_ms = 1500